Ok so i have gone over the videos and a few photos.
Position 1.
No time limit.
First shot at a 10" target at 116m, if the first shot hits, fire the second shot at the 6" target at the same location. If the first shot misses fire the second shot at the 10" target.
5 points per hit, 2 shots.
Position 2.
40 second time limit.
Competitor starts standing three shots in the magazine. At the begining of the time limit the competitor shall move forward to the shoot location. The competitor shall fire the first shot at the left hand 10" target (107m), their second shot at the right hand 10" target (101m) and their third shot at the left hand 10" target again.
5 points per hit. You had to shoot kneeling really.

Position 3.
30 second time limit.
Competitor starts standing three shots in the magazine. At the begining of the time limit the competitor shall move forward to the shoot location. The competitor shall fire the first shot at the lower 6" target (98m), their second shot at the middle 10" target (100m) and their third shot at the upper 6" target (108m)
5 points per hit. Most either shot kneeling supported off the post or prone through a thistle.

Position 4.
12 second time limit.
Competitor starts standing three shots in the magazine. At the begining of the time limit the competitor fires their first shot at the left hand 10" target. The competitor must move to shoot the middle 10" target and then can fire their third shot at the right hand 10" target. All targets were about 20m away.
5 points per hit. You had to shoot standing to see the targets.

Position 5 - mad minute (kindov)
45 second time limit.
Competitor starts standing with 5 shots in their mag (if they could, bolt had to be open). At the begining of the time limit the competitor had two 6" targets (94m & 150m) and three 10" targets (133m, 166m, 191m) to fire one shot each at.
5 points per hit.

Position 6.
60 second time limit.
Competitor starts standing with 4 shots in in their mag (if they could, bolt had to be open). At the begining of the time limit the competitor had to fire their first shot at a 14" target. If hit they would fire the second shot at a 10" target, if hit they would fire the third shot at a 6" target, if hit they would fire their last shot at the 6" target again. A miss would require the competitor to fire the next shot at the larger sized target.
5 points per hit.
